Output 50dc5181a9fe17f36fd13947f80c8e288776508125ab7995ccf412d0ab903857:15

value
38033151
script pubkey
OP_0 OP_PUSHBYTES_20 a43b44eb21c2e6a9e164a8c4fa3db6345ba1a8ad
address
ltc1q5sa5f6epctn2ncty4rz050dkx3d6r29d7dd80h
transaction
50dc5181a9fe17f36fd13947f80c8e288776508125ab7995ccf412d0ab903857
spent
true